Transaction 5bcb139ffc20f85113eebe979388b75fdb7e274184693d61dc3cec2b79cae93a

1 Input
2 Outputs
  • 5bcb139ffc20f85113eebe979388b75fdb7e274184693d61dc3cec2b79cae93a:0
  • value  4511628
    address  3EtXtnvK4x5MbjSzpm1FhPxo7gQjjoYHmV
  • 5bcb139ffc20f85113eebe979388b75fdb7e274184693d61dc3cec2b79cae93a:1
  • value  11418805
    address  3Dwxm4u3hFgJPfbcSTQv8kJRSrQqy7jJt3